Q: What are the very best materials for a conservatory upgrade?A: The best products for a conservatory upgrade depend on your particular requirements and choices. Timber frames provide a conventional and natural look however need routine maintenance. uPVC frames are low-maintenance and energy-efficient but might not have the very same visual appeal as timber. Aluminum frames are durable and contemporary, making them a popular choice for modern designs. For glazing, double or triple glazing with low-E coverings is advised for optimal energy effectiveness.
Q: How can I make my conservatory more energy-efficient?A: To make your conservatory more energy-efficient, think about the following:
Insulation: Upgrade the insulation in the walls, floor, and roof to lower heat loss.Glazing: Install double or triple glazing with low-E finishings to enhance thermal performance.Sealing: Ensure all windows and doors are effectively sealed to prevent drafts.Cooling and heating: Install energy-efficient heating and cooling systems, such as underfloor heating and ceiling fans.Shading: Use blinds, curtains, or external shading to manage the quantity of sunshine getting in the conservatory, reducing the need for a/c.
